SCHEDULE II

                                      INFORMATION WITH RESPECT TO
                           TRANSACTIONS EFFECTED DURING THE PAST SIXTY DAYS OR
                           SINCE THE MOST RECENT FILING ON SCHEDULE 13D (1)

                                             SHARES PURCHASED        AVERAGE
                                  DATE            SOLD(-)             PRICE(2)

           COMMON STOCK-SPS TECHNOLOGIES

                    GAMCO INVESTORS, INC.
                                 1/10/02            5,000            32.0000
                                 1/10/02           10,000            32.1974
                                 1/10/02              200            31.9500
                                 1/10/02           15,000            32.1974
                                 1/10/02            3,000            31.6433
                                 1/07/02            1,800            35.2778
                                 1/07/02              500            35.0800
                                 1/03/02            1,000            35.0000
                                 1/02/02              500            33.9900
                                 1/02/02            1,000-           34.0000
                                12/31/01              300-           36.1200
                                12/31/01            3,650-           36.0086
                                12/31/01            2,500            35.9320
                                12/31/01              220-             *DO
                                12/31/01              220-             *DO
                                12/28/01              300-           36.1300
                                12/28/01              200-           36.1300
                                12/27/01            4,000-           35.6765
                                12/27/01              300-             *DO
                                12/27/01            1,000-           35.8280
                                12/26/01            1,000            35.5350
                                12/26/01            3,000            35.6253
                                12/26/01              500-           34.1800
                                12/26/01            4,700            35.4991
                                12/24/01            3,300            34.1970
                                12/24/01           10,000            34.8510
                                12/21/01            2,200-           33.1636
                                12/20/01              300            33.5000
                                12/19/01            2,000            33.9930
                                12/19/01            4,525            33.8731
                                12/18/01            3,200            33.9838
                                12/17/01           24,995-             *DO
                                12/14/01              700            32.3500
                                12/14/01            2,000            32.8800
                                12/14/01            2,000            32.9710
                                12/12/01            5,000            31.8634
                                12/12/01              200            31.2800
                                12/11/01              500            31.4700
                                12/10/01            1,000-           31.0500
                                12/10/01              500            31.3920
                                12/07/01            1,000            31.1930
                                12/07/01            1,000-           31.1600
                                12/07/01            7,500-           31.5453
                                12/07/01              300-           31.5000
                                12/06/01            1,000            31.6280
                                12/06/01            1,000-           31.1600
                                12/06/01            1,500-           31.1600
                                12/06/01            1,000            31.0490
                                12/04/01            2,000            30.9750
                                12/04/01              300-           31.0000
                                12/03/01              500            32.0900
                                12/03/01              500-             *DO
                                11/29/01            1,500            32.4827
                                11/28/01              100-           31.7500
                                11/28/01              573            32.2651
                                11/27/01              300            31.8000
                                11/27/01            4,850            32.0327
                                11/26/01              200-             *DO
                                11/26/01            1,700            32.2400
                                11/23/01            5,000            32.6244
                                11/21/01            3,000            32.4530
                                11/21/01            1,000-           32.4100
                                11/21/01            6,500            32.4822
                                11/21/01            3,300-           32.3764
                                11/21/01            1,500-             *DO
                                11/20/01            1,000            32.5300
                                11/20/01            1,000            32.3300
                                11/20/01              200            32.3900
                                11/19/01            5,000            29.2580
                                11/19/01            5,000            31.0464
                                11/19/01            4,900            30.0328
                                11/19/01            2,000            30.7715
                                11/19/01            3,000            31.2000
                                11/19/01            5,000            29.8250
                                11/19/01            5,000-           29.8250
                                11/19/01            4,900-           30.0328
                                11/19/01            3,000            31.2000
                                11/19/01            2,000            30.7715
                                11/19/01            5,000            29.8250
                                11/19/01            4,900            29.7892
                                11/19/01            3,000-           31.2000
                                11/19/01            2,000-           30.7715
                                11/16/01            2,500            29.4300
                                11/16/01            1,000-           29.6770
                                11/16/01            1,000            29.6540
                                11/16/01            2,500            29.6540
                                11/16/01            1,500-           29.6693
                                11/16/01            2,300            29.4848
                                11/16/01            1,500            29.6540
                                11/15/01            2,000            29.2600
                                11/15/01            1,500            29.2670
                                11/15/01            2,000            29.3855
                                11/14/01              200            29.4100
                                11/13/01            2,000            28.2700
                                11/13/01            6,000            28.3067
                                11/13/01              300            28.0000
                     GABELLI FUNDS, LLC.
                         GABELLI SMALL CAP GROWTH FUND
                                11/19/01            5,000            29.5434
                         GABELLI ASSET FUND
                                11/15/01           10,000            29.3343


          (1) UNLESS OTHERWISE INDICATED, ALL TRANSACTIONS WERE EFFECTED
              ON THE NYSE.

          (2) PRICE EXCLUDES COMMISSION.

          (*) RESULTS IN CHANGE OF DISPOSITIVE POWER AND BENEFICIAL OWNERSHIP.